1
 Values relate to package being used on a standard 2-layer PCB, which gives a
worst-case ?SPAN class="pst ADT6402SRJZ-RL7_2322505_6">JA. Refer to Figure 2 for a plot of maximum power dissipation vs.
ambient temperature (TA).
2
 T
A
 = ambient temperature.
3
 Junction-to-case resistance is applicable to components featuring a
preferential flow direction, for example, components mounted on a
heat sink. Junction-to-ambient resistance is more useful for air-cooled,
PCB-mounted components.
Stresses above those listed under Absolute Maximum Ratings
may cause permanent damage to the device. This is a stress
rating only; functional operation of the device at these or any
other conditions above those indicated in the operational
section of this specification is not implied. Exposure to absolute
maximum rating conditions for extended periods may affect
device reliability.
